在单人游戏中,要实现矩形的缩小和增长,可以通过以下步骤:
- 获取矩形的当前尺寸:在游戏中,矩形通常由其宽度和高度来定义。可以使用编程语言中的变量来存储当前的宽度和高度值。
- 缩小矩形:要缩小矩形,可以通过减小宽度和高度的值来实现。可以根据游戏设计的需要,选择一个适当的缩小速度,然后在每个游戏帧中减小宽度和高度的值。
- 增大矩形:要增大矩形,可以通过增加宽度和高度的值来实现。同样地,可以选择一个适当的增大速度,并在每个游戏帧中增加宽度和高度的值。
- 更新矩形的显示:在每个游戏帧中,需要将更新后的宽度和高度值应用到矩形的显示上,以确保玩家可以看到矩形的缩小和增大效果。
需要注意的是,以上步骤是一个基本的实现思路,具体的实现方式会根据游戏引擎或开发框架的不同而有所差异。在实际开发中,可以根据具体需求进行调整和优化。
推荐的腾讯云相关产品:腾讯云游戏多媒体引擎 GME(Game Multimedia Engine)
产品介绍链接地址:https://cloud.tencent.com/product/gme